The evolution of color vision in insects

A D Briscoe1, L Chittka

  • 1Department of Molecular and Cellular Biology, University of Arizona, Tucson, Arizona 85721, USA. abriscoe@u.arizona.edu

Summary

Insect color vision evolved from a basic UV-blue-green system in ancient ancestors. Variations in color receptors exist, but evolutionary history and chance, not just adaptation, shape these insect visual systems.
